Address

DM3MP52i7gxsFFP15ZwwXAtRnGCcNvkxMPCopy

Total Received

1112.931236 XVG

Total Sent

1112.931236 XVG

№ Transactions

3

Final Balance

0 XVG

Transactions
Filter